This research aims to determine whether the Quantum Learning model based on the Scientific approach can provide better learning outcomes rather than direct learning model. This research is a quasi experimental research with matching static group comparison design. The research instrument used to obtain data is in the form of documentation and test. The calculation of the hypothesis test the value of tcount > ttable where tcount = 1.83 and ttable = 1.68 at the significant level of 5% with dk=50. The conclusions from the analysis of the hypothesis test is that the Quantum Learning model based on Scientific approach provides better learning outcomes than students who were taught using direct learning models.

This study aims to: analyze the needs of teachers, feasibility and effectiveness in the development of learning tools based on Problem Based Learning (PBL) model to improve 7th grade students' Science learning outcomes in SMPN 2 Bongan. The results of the observation is in the form of teacher needs analysis instrument analyzed using qualitative descriptive. Observation results obtained that the use of Problem Based Learning model in Science learning process had not been optimally implemented in schools, problems obtained in teachers are: 1) teachers still had difficulties in understanding and composing learning tools, 2) teachers still had difficulties in determining the appropriate learning model, 3) teachers were still less creative, 4) lack of facilities and infrastructure provided in schools for teachers to be more innovative in learning. Problems obtained in students are: 1) low mastery on the subject matter, students were only able to answer the problem of C1 to C3 thinking levels, 2) Science learning only embraced the concept so that students felt lack of interest in learning, 3) students were not engaging in learning, 4) low level of student learning outcomes.

The objective of this research is produce science learning tools that eligible for  the completeness of learning outcome student’s  at subject human motion system  on the junior high school. The development of this learning tools is based on 3-D model  by using test based on One Group Pretest-Posttest Design. The test is conducted on eighth grade student of SMP Negeri Rasiei Teluk Wondama district-Papua Barat. The research consisted of two stages which is: 1) Developing the learning tools consisted of lesson plan, student’s book, and student’s worksheet, learning achievement test validated by experts. 2) the lesson learning tools which has been  validated by expert is a tested. The instrumental used including observational sheet of student’s activity, and student’s response questionnaire. He result of the research shows that: 1) the learning tools is valid; 2) the lesson plan accoplishment is categorized as good; 3) the student’s activities indicate tha they learn to actively build their own knowledge through a scientific approach; 4) the student’s responded positively to the learning process; 5) the student’s learning outcomes of attitude, knowledge, and skill aspects is accomplished. Based on the following results can be concluded that the science learning tools based scientific approach on human motion system is a valid, practical, and effective. Thus the science learning tools can be used on the learning process and proofed to be effective for the completeness of student’s learning outcome
